Position Summary

This position assists with development of strategic marketing plans, recruits clients, negotiates and monitors contracts and preferred vendor agreements, and sets operating targets. The role assists with managing budgets and prepares operational reports for executive level decision making, manages room calendars and prepares invoices for space usage, coordinates tours, and develops and executes effective communication processes and materials for optimum stakeholder interaction.

The Conference and Event Coordinator performs operations duties such as general facility oversight, space management, building access and resource acquisition. This role also assists with onboarding/offboarding employees. This position is located primarily at the CHM Secchia Center in Grand Rapids Michigan and requires significant on-site presence.

The Conference and Event Coordinator works closely with contracted security and custodial staff, as well as MSU IT and Facilities staff to coordinate event logistics. This position interacts with faculty, staff, students, external vendors, community partners and MSU units such as Academic Affairs, External Relations, and Advancement, among others, to coordinate events. This position reports to the CHM West Michigan Operations Director and works closely with other members of the Operations and Facilities team, including the CHM Director of Security, CHM parking administrator, and Building Services Engineer.

Minimum Requirements

Knowledge equivalent to that which would normally be acquired by completing a four-year college degree program in Hotel, Restaurant and Institutional Management or a related business field; three to five years of related and progressively more responsible or expansive work experience in institutional housing or institutional conference coordination; or an equivalent combination of education and experience.

Desired Qualifications

Knowledge equivalent to that which normally would be acquired by completing a four year college degree program with three years of related and progressively more responsible or expansive work experience in institutional conference coordination and facilities management or a related field; working knowledge of institutional scheduling systems; excellent verbal and written communication skills and outstanding customer service, with the ability to positively interact with internal and external stakeholders; exceptional organizational skills with proficiency in multitasking, time management, and completing tasks with minimal supervision; demonstrated critical thinking and creative problem solving capacity; computer and software aptitude with an emphasis on word processing, spreadsheets, and presentation software; or an equivalent combination of education and experience.

Bachelor’s degree in Business or Hotel, Restaurant and Institutional Management or a related field of study; experience in coordinating conferences in an academic setting; experience with contract management; ability to recruit clients; knowledgeable of applicable health and safety regulations; ability to effectively interpret and synthesize information.
